Latest Patents
Indrajit's latest patents include a "Magnetic flux assembly for a relay" and a "Monolithic carrier body for a relay." The magnetic flux assembly is designed to close a magnetic circuit of a relay, featuring a yoke and a U-shaped armature that moves relative to the yoke. The yoke contains a coil part that is wound in a coil and a flux conduction part that effectively conducts the magnetic flux generated by the coil. The monolithic carrier body for a relay consists of a base body, a coil carrier, and a contact mount, all formed as a single unit. The coil carrier and contact mount extend from the base body, providing a streamlined design.
